
Vodacom Bulls coach Johan Ackermann kept his word by selecting a powerful starting XV for Saturday’s Investec Champions Cup match against the Bristol Bears at Loftus Versfeld, 15:00 (SA Time).
Ten Springboks are in the starting line-up, which will again be led by Ruan Nortje.
There is a welcome return to the team, too, for Embrose Papier, who last week turned in a Man of the Match performance after being called up at the 11th hour. His pairing with Handre Piollard will be crucial in helping shape the side’s ambitions.
The solid midfield firm of Harold Vorster and David Kriel is also reunited, although Canan Moodie misses out due to concussion protocols.
Bristol have a full house of points in the Investec Champions Cup - two wins from as many starts - while the Vodacom Bulls have yet to record a win after two matches.
This fixture, therefore, looms as a must-win affair for the home team if they are to keep their playoff hopes alive.
